Aside from all of that, euchre, simply put, is fun. Unlike poker,
there doesn't have to be any money at stake for players to have a
good time.
Euchre also promotes teamwork. Partners must work together in order
to be successful. If your partner is a stone idiot, you might get
lucky with a couple of loners, but it is more likely that you will
end up going "down with the ship" so to speak. In poker, you are on
your own, and if you don't spot the stone idiot at the table after
you first five minutes, then it just might be you.
In a euchre game, you are going to play in every hand, unless of
course your partner goes alone. In poker, you are likely to lose your
ass if you stay in more than half of the hands. The better poker
players spend a lot of time folding and waiting for good cards to
come (which gives them more time to complain about life).
